What is a Mini PC?
Defining a Mini PC
A mini PC, also known as a small form factor (SFF) PC, is a compact desktop computer designed to offer the functionality of a traditional desktop in a significantly smaller package. They typically range in size from a small book to a smartphone, making them ideal for space-constrained environments.
How They Differ From Traditional Desktops
- Size: Mini PCs are dramatically smaller, often fitting in the palm of your hand.
- Power Consumption: They generally consume less power than traditional desktops, making them more energy-efficient.
- Portability: Their small size makes them easier to transport.
- Expandability: Traditionally, mini PCs offered limited expandability, but modern models are becoming increasingly versatile.
Common Use Cases
- Home Theater PC (HTPC): Perfect for streaming movies, TV shows, and music.
- Office Workstation: Ideal for everyday tasks like word processing, spreadsheets, and web browsing.
- Digital Signage: Used for displaying information in retail stores, restaurants, and public spaces.
- Gaming (Limited): Some high-end mini PCs can handle light to moderate gaming.
- Embedded Systems: Utilized in industrial applications, robotics, and IoT devices.

Key Features to Consider
Processor (CPU)
- Intel vs. AMD: Choose between Intel and AMD processors based on your performance needs and budget. Intel generally offers better single-core performance, while AMD provides better value for multi-core tasks.
- Number of Cores and Threads: Consider the number of cores and threads based on your workload. More cores and threads are beneficial for multitasking and demanding applications.
- Clock Speed: Higher clock speeds generally translate to faster performance.
Memory (RAM)
- Capacity: Aim for at least 8GB of RAM for basic tasks and 16GB or more for demanding applications or multitasking.
- Speed: Faster RAM speeds can improve overall system performance.
- Type: DDR4 is the current standard, with DDR5 becoming increasingly common in newer models.
Storage (SSD/HDD)
- SSD vs. HDD: SSDs (Solid State Drives) offer significantly faster performance compared to HDDs (Hard Disk Drives). Choose an SSD for your primary drive for faster boot times and application loading.
- Capacity: Choose a storage capacity based on your needs. 256GB is a good starting point for basic use, while 512GB or 1TB is recommended for storing large files or installing numerous applications.
- NVMe vs. SATA: NVMe SSDs offer even faster performance compared to SATA SSDs.
Ports and Connectivity
- USB Ports: Ensure the mini PC has a sufficient number of USB ports, including USB 3.0 or USB 3.1 for faster data transfer speeds.
- HDMI/DisplayPort: Choose a model with the appropriate video outputs for your monitor(s).
- Ethernet Port: Essential for a stable and reliable network connection.
- Wi-Fi and Bluetooth: Ensure the mini PC supports the latest Wi-Fi standards (e.g., Wi-Fi 6) and Bluetooth for wireless connectivity.
Graphics (GPU)
- Integrated Graphics: Most mini PCs come with integrated graphics, which are sufficient for basic tasks and light gaming.
- Dedicated Graphics: Some high-end mini PCs offer dedicated graphics cards for improved gaming and graphics-intensive performance. Consider these if you plan on doing any serious gaming or video editing.
Operating System
- Windows: The most common operating system for mini PCs, offering broad compatibility with software and hardware.
- Linux: A free and open-source operating system that is popular for its flexibility and customization options.
- Barebone Systems: Some mini PCs are sold as barebone systems, requiring you to install your own operating system.

Practical Examples and Tips
- Home Office: A mini PC with an Intel Core i5 processor, 8GB of RAM, and a 256GB SSD is a great option for general office work. Consider a model with multiple display outputs for improved productivity.
- Media Center: A mini PC with an HDMI 2.0 port, 4GB of RAM, and a 128GB SSD is sufficient for streaming 4K content. Consider a model with a built-in IR receiver for remote control functionality.
- Gaming: A mini PC with a dedicated graphics card, 16GB of RAM, and a 512GB SSD is recommended for gaming. Check the specific graphics card to ensure it meets the requirements of the games you want to play.
